HS Code for Styrene film
Styrene film is classified under HS code 3920.30. This code falls under heading 3920, which includes plates, sheets, film, foil, and strip of plastics that are non-cellular and not reinforced, laminated, supported, or similarly combined with other materials. The classification process involves identifying the polymer type and the physical structure of the plastic. Since the film is made from polymers of styrene and lacks a cellular (foam-like) internal structure, it is directed to subheading 3920.30. This classification excludes products that have been treated with adhesives or those that have been reinforced with fiberglass or metal. The material must be flat and have a consistent thickness to meet the definition of film or sheet under this heading. It is commonly used in packaging, printing, and industrial applications where a clear or rigid styrene-based surface is required.

Common Misclassification
Styrene film is frequently misclassified under HS code 3919.10 or 3919.90 if it has a self-adhesive backing. Heading 3919 specifically takes precedence for adhesive-coated plastics. Another common error is using HS code 3921.11, which is reserved for cellular (foam) plates and sheets made of styrene. If the film is reinforced with a textile or metal layer, it would also move to heading 3921. Additionally, if the film is worked beyond simple surface treatment (e.g., cut into specific shapes other than rectangles), it may be classified as an article of plastic under 3926.
FAQ
What is the HS code for Styrene film?
The HS code for non-cellular, non-reinforced styrene film is 3920.30.
Is polystyrene foam classified under this code?
No, polystyrene foam is a cellular plastic and is classified under HS code 3921.11, not 3920.30.

Is the HS code for Styrene film the same in all countries?
The base HS code 392030 for Styrene film is internationally standardized for the first 6 digits across 200+ countries. Individual countries may add additional digits for national tariff lines and specific classifications.
